Claims
- 1. A temperature gauge assembly for surgical drills of the type having a surgical head to which a drill bur is removably mounted comprising:
- a drill bur having a throughbore extending to a drill bur tip;
- temperature sensor means receivable in the drill bur throughbore for sensing and measuring the temperature at the drill bur tip; and
- thermometer means coupled to said temperature sensor means for displaying the temperature at the drill bur tip.
- 2. The temperature gauge assembly of claim 1, wherein said temperature sensor means comprises a two-wire thermocouple probe.
- 3. The temperature gauge assembly of claim 1, wherein said thermometer means comprises a microprocessor-based thermometer having a digital display.
- 4. The temperature gauge assembly of claim 2, additionally including a connector for removably coupling said thermocouple probe to said thermometer means.
- 5. A method of measuring the temperature of the drill site in the bone of a patient comprising the steps of:
- drilling a hole in the bone of a patient with a surgical drill using at least one drill bur, said at least one drill bur being of the type having a central throughbore extending to a drill bur tip;
- sensing, measuring and monitoring the temperature at the drill site via temperature sensing means receivable in said drill bur throughbore of the drill bur being used in drilling and thermometer means coupled to said temperature sensing means for displaying the temperature sensed thereby; and
- maintaining the temperature of the drill site at the tip of said drill bur being used in drilling below 47.degree. C. during said step of drilling.
- 6. The method of claim 5, wherein said step of drilling includes drilling a hole in the bone of the patient with a surgical drill using drill burs of progressively increasing diameter, until such time that a hole of predetermined diameter and depth is achieved.
